Yes - the taillight is just "sitting" in the rear cowl....and the eagle eyed among you might notice the rear subframe is a little twisted. Looks like the PO has had a fall on the LHS.......hang on......I'm pretty sure they're supposed to have a 4-2 exhaust.......wheres the left muffler??
PO has cut off the muffler and just plugged the header. Oh dear.....
And the centre stand is supposed to have a foot lever on it, isn't it??
Double Oh dear......
Anyway, closer inspection has revealed the bike also has no air filter, no water in the radiator, about a litre of petrol in the sump and about a kilo of bondo in the bottom of the gas tank (to stop it leaking through the rust holes...). Some people don't deserve motorcycles :
BUT....I did a very quick carb clean, changed the oil, threw in a charged battery and the bike fired up. All sounds pretty good
So, I think this one might be a keeper as a daily rider. Not a cafe, but a Big Arsed project nonetheless......quite literally ;D
